Retail Banking Division

Senior Teller

37.5 hours per week

Fishkill Main Branch

Fishkill, NY

THE OPPORTUNITY:

Serves as foundation of building customer loyalty in the M&T branch system, completing all activities in a pro-active manner. Plays key role in the Customer Experience (lobby experience, needs identification, Easy Deposit migration, directing to appropriate resource and top five behaviors), Transactions (efficient transactions, profiling customers for sales opportunities, account maintenance and providing service beyond expectations) and Risk Management (audit requirements, fraud prevention, Know Your Customer (KYC) activities, Customer Information Profile (CIP) maintenance and branch operations) to support achievement of branch goals.

Acknowledges customers entering the branch, accurately processes a variety of financial transactions and balances work daily, identifies and refers sales opportunities by uncovering financial needs and presenting all options to customers and following up as needed.

POSITION RESPONSIBILITIES:

Support Bank guidelines for delivering exceptional customer experience including proactively greeting customers, smiling, using their name and ending each interaction (whether in person or phone) by saying "Thank you for banking with M&T. Is there anything else I can do for you today (customer name)?" Maintain a professional demeanor and appearance to build customer confidence and trust.

Take ownership of error resolution including resolving customer problems and referring complex issues to supervisor or platform. Follow-up on these issues as required to ensure timely and accurate resolution. Handle situations escalated by a Teller in the same manner.

Process a variety of Retail and Commercial transactions, including deposits, withdrawals, loan payments and check cashing, in an accurate and efficient manner.

Verify check endorsements and funds availability and disburse cash to customers in the conduct of transactions and according to policy. Issue receipts to customers for transactions processed to provide a record of activity. Balance daily work, adhering to all procedures stated in the Employee Difference policy.

Maintain thorough knowledge of procedures required for ATM (Automated Teller Machine) settlement, Canadian currency, night depository, reserve cash and coin maintenance, negotiable control and review, opening and closing procedures, ordering of cash, and preparation of cash for shipment and receipt of cash shipment. Input information into the Automated Balancing System (ABS) and Currency Transaction Reporting (CTR) system to provide a record of activity.

Ensure compliance with operational, security and control policies/procedures to support preventing fraud and protecting customer assets.

Identify customer needs and present all appropriate options to achieve personal referral goals by proactively identifying referral opportunities utilizing fundamentals of M&T Bank's sales process. Participate in branch sales promotions as requested by management.

Provide guidance and training to new or newly assigned Tellers as necessary.

Ensure proper handling and tracking of qualified Teller referrals.

Serve as Customer Experience or Operations Teller-in-Charge, depending on branch size and complexity. Teller-in-Charge responsibilities serve as customer service referral champion, and within Tier 1 or 2 branches, coordinating branch promotions, ensuring branch and merchandising standards are maintained, serving as workflow coordinator, creating Teller schedules, providing sales and service leadership to Tellers, ensuring consistent execution of all activities and attending operations meetings conducted by Regional Operations. In larger Tiers, the position supports the Teller Manager.

Demonstrate teamwork by proactively assisting other branch colleagues when needed as well as actively participating and contributing during Branch Team meetings. Lead portions of the meetings as necessary.

Understand and adhere to the Company's risk and regulatory standards, policies and controls in accordance with the Company's Risk Appetite. Identify risk-related issues needing escalation to management.

Promote an environment that supports diversity and reflects the M&T Bank brand.

Maintain M&T internal control standards, including timely implementation of internal and external audit points together with any issues raised by external regulators as applicable.

Complete other related duties as assigned.

Responsible for meeting and maintaining registration requirements under the Federal SAFE Act.

NATURE AND SCOPE:

The position is responsible for providing exceptional service to branch customers and resolving customer problems in a timely manner. The position is a key driver of branch referrals that assist the branch team achieve annual sales goals. The position is responsible for interacting with appropriate areas within the Bank to ensure branch-related operational issues are resolved efficiently and accurately. The position mentors new or newly-assigned Tellers, or takes lead role in bringing new Tellers on board as part of the branch team. It is important for the position to stay current on operational changes and demonstrate good risk management decisions to assist the branch in managing preventable losses and reducing fraudulent activity.
